Key Features That Boost Your Workflow


Not all software is created equal. The right tool has features tailored for construction projects. Here’s what to look for:


Task Management and Scheduling


Assign tasks, set deadlines, and track progress. No more guessing who’s doing what or when. A clear schedule keeps everyone accountable.


Communication Tools


Chat, video calls, and message boards keep conversations organized. No more lost emails or missed calls. Everyone stays in the loop.


Document Sharing and Storage


Blueprints, contracts, permits - all stored safely and accessible anytime. No more digging through piles of paper or endless email threads.


Budget Tracking


Keep an eye on costs in real-time. Spot overruns early and adjust before they spiral out of control.


Mobile Access


Construction sites are busy places. Mobile apps let you check updates, approve changes, or send messages on the go.

How to Choose the Right Project Collaboration Software


Picking the right software can feel overwhelming. Here’s a simple checklist to guide you:


  1. Ease of Use - Your team should get it without hours of training.

  2. Customization - Can you tailor it to your project’s needs?

  3. Integration - Does it work with your existing tools?

  4. Support - Is help available when you need it?

  5. Cost - Fits your budget without skimping on essentials.


Try demos or free trials. Get feedback from your team. The right fit makes all the difference.


Getting Your Team Onboard


Even the best software fails if your team doesn’t use it. Here’s how to get everyone on board:


  • Start Small - Introduce one feature at a time.

  • Train Thoroughly - Hands-on sessions work best.

  • Show Benefits - Highlight how it saves time and reduces headaches.

  • Encourage Feedback - Make adjustments based on real user input.

  • Lead by Example - Use the software yourself every day.


When your team sees the value, adoption happens naturally.
